I have for years been using a V-box to time my 100 - 200km/h (62 - 124mph) and 100 - 160km/h times (62 - 100mph) for tuning purposes and evaluating changes. My SL55 does these intervals in 7.3sec and 3.8sec and will do a 125mph trap. I care little about the ET as it is meaningless outside of actual heads up drag racing and irrelevant against awd cars. Using these intervals one can then compare to road test figures to see how your car compares. Road tests are all in kph it seems. Comparing these times along with my trap speed confirm that with a 1.5sec 60ft my car is a high 10sec 1/4 miler. The 125mph speed and 1930kg weight with driver plugged into the formula, gives 650 rwhp. One doesn't have to put extreme loads through the drive train chasing low 60 foots to get a very good idea as to how your car compares in the real world (on the street) to other cars.
